AI Summary
- State Department of Education must acquire and distribute copies of the book "One Mississippi" to all public school districts and charter schools for every Grade 2 student, beginning with the 2026-2027 school year
- Parents or legal guardians are required to purchase the book at cost as a component of necessary instruction, with schools prohibited from making any profit on sales
- Schools must inventory all books received and ensure instruction is administered annually during "Read Across America Week"
- The Department must develop and provide a lesson plan template covering the content and significance of the book, which teachers must follow
- Effective date: July 1, 2026, subject to appropriation of funds
Legislative Description
One Mississippi; require State Dept of Ed. to provide copies for sale to students in Grade 2 for instruction during "Read Across America Week."
